Java中的regex分割逗号分隔的字符串,但忽略双引号之间的逗号

时间:2019-08-07 12:08:17

标签: java regex

我的正则表达式无法处理 a)以下的问题,但通过了 b)。我必须处理逗号后面不加“。”的情况。

我使用的正则表达式是:-

,(?=(?:[^\\\"]*\\\"[^\\\"]*\\\")*[^\\\"]*$) 

a) clean lname,,GandtTe,,:,.{}[]()~^*"@#$%&!\/'><;Gandt,Terry,L,,F,S,,7901 W Denver Ave,

b) 02, ,3006,101791106,,Lantz,Jon,Dow,,F,Unknown,,\"3301, Kntario Ave\",,,Kelando,5546215,FL,32806,,United States,,,,,,test@gmail.com,2306988547,19931325,20150825,Hourly 

0 个答案:

没有答案